<p><br><br><br><br><br><br><br><span style="font-size: 12px; color: #f4f5f5;">Rotary wheel blow molding systems are used for the highoutput production of a wide variety of plastic extrusion blow molded articles. Containers may be produced from small, single serve bottles to large containers up to 2030 liters in volume  but wheel machines are often sized for the volume and dimensional demands of a specific container, and are typically dedicated to a narrow range of bottle sizes once built. The main house is a 2 12 story timber frame structure, five bays wide and three bays deep, whose construction date is traditionally given as 1772. There is, however, architectural evidence that it may be older c. 1750. The building has a small 19th century addition, whose purpose was to provide a staircase for hired farmhands to reach the attic, where their living space was. The downstairs spaces have retained much of their original Georgian fabric, although a pantry space has been converted into a modern kitchen. There are five outbuildings on the 1.3acre 0.53160ha property, including a 19thcentury wagon shed and horse barn.
